Availability of Longer Hitch Pin for Yakima Bike Racks

Question:
I need a replacement bolt for a Yakima KingPin bike rack. I just purchased a newer Tacoma. For some reason when I screw the existing bolt into the new 2inch receiver hitch it is not quite long enough for me to put on the locking cap on the left side. The existing bolt has a 7/8inch head and overall length of 4 inches. Im looking for a similar bolt that is about 4 1/4inch long with the same thread and diameter. Can you help pick one out? Expert Reply:
The part # Y8890200 is 4-1/2 inches long which may be longer than what you currently have since some of the pins are only 4 inches long.
